Web27 feb. 2024 · Gifts up to Rs 50,000 per annum are exempt from tax in India. In addition, gifts from specific relatives like parents, spouse and siblings are also exempt from tax. Gifts in other cases are taxable. Tax on gifts in India falls under the purview of the Income Tax Act as there is no specific gift tax after the Gift Tax Act, 1958 was repealed in 1998. WebIf the person gifting the deposit dies within 7 years, you may be liable to pay inheritance tax. This depends on how large their estate is – if it is worth over £325,000 (including the gifted deposit) you may have to pay inheritance tax.
